Materials | Linear Ranges (µM) | LOD (µM) | Ref. |
---|---|---|---|
CS-FeO | 0.34–4.46 | 0.187 µM | [4] |
AA-P3TAA | 0.5–100 | 0.5 µM | [6] |
Silver nanoparticle-modified electrode | 0.0412–7.90 | 0.0412 µM | [30] |
Carbon nanoparticles and halloysite nanoclay modified CPE | 0.0012–4.81 | 0.00038 µM | [31] |
Zn2SnO4/SnO2/GCE | 0.01–8.7; 8.7–78.4 | 0.0059 µM | This work |
